- Nanometer-scale structure differences in the myofilament lattice spacing of two cockroach leg muscles correspond to their different functions
Highlighted Article: A single nanometer difference in the spacing of actin and myosin between two muscles may help account for the muscles’ different locomotor functions.
- Cockroaches use diverse strategies to self-right on the ground
Summary: Comparative study of cockroach self-righting reveals performance advantages of using rotational kinetic energy to overcome the potential energy barrier and rolling more to lower it while maintaining diverse strategies.
